1.maven添加spring、redis、log4j依赖
properties设置
<properties>
<project.build.sourceEncoding>UTF-8</project.build.sourceEncoding>
<spring.version>4.3.0.RELEASE</spring.version>
<jedis.version>2.1.0</jedis.version>
<springdateredis.version>1.0.2.RELEASE</springdateredis.version>
</properties>
相关dependency
<!-- spring 依赖 -->
<dependency>
<groupId>org.springframework</groupId>
<artifactId>spring-core</artifactId>
<version>${spring.version}</version>
</dependency>
<dependency>
<groupId>org.springframework</groupId>
<artifactId>spring-beans</artifactId>
<version>${spring.version}</version>
</dependency>
<dependency>
<groupId>org.springframework</groupId>
<artifactId>spring-context</artifactId>
<version>${spring.version}</version>
</dependency>
<!-- springredis -->
<dependency>
<groupId>org.springframework.data</groupId>
<artifactId>spring-data-redis</artifactId>
<version>${springdateredis.version}</version>
</dependency>
<!-- redis 依赖 -->
<dependency>
<groupId>redis.clients</groupId>
<artifactId>jedis</artifactId>
<version>${jedis.version}</version>
</dependency>
<!-- log4j日志 -->
<dependency>
<groupId>org.apache.logging.log4j</groupId>
<artifactId>log4j-core</artifactId>
<version>2.7</version>
</dependency>
2.新建dao接口
package com.lgd.ssh.spider.Dao;
import java.util.List;
import java.util.Map;
public interface RedisDao {
/**
* 向redis添加数据
*
* @param addMap<key,
* value>
*/
public void add(Map<String, String> addMap);
/**
* 删除redis数据
*
* @param deleteList<key>
*/
public void delete(List<String> deleteList);
/**
* 更新redis数据
*
* @param updateMap<key,
* value>
*/
public void update(Map<String, String> updateMap);
/**
* 查询
*
* @param queryList
*/
public Map<String, String> query(List<String> queryList);
}
3.具体实现
redisbase类
package com.lgd.ssh.spider.Dao.Spi;
import redis.clients.jedis.Jedis;
import redis.clients.jedis.JedisPool;
import redis.clients.jedis.Pipeline;
/**
* redis基类
* @author lgd
*
*/
public class RedisBaseDao {
private static JedisPool jedisPool;
public static JedisPool getJedisPool() {
return jedisPool;
}
public static void setJedisPool(JedisPool jedisPool) {
RedisBaseDao.jedisPool = jedisPool;
}
private Jedis getJedis() {
return jedisPool.getResource();
}
private Jedis getJedisClient() {
return getJedis();
}
private Pipeline getPipeline() {
Jedis jedis = getJedisClient();
return jedis.pipelined();
}
public <T> T RedisExecute(RedisExecute<T> redisExcute){
Pipeline pipeline = getPipeline();
return redisExcute.Execute(pipeline);
}
}
RedisExecute接口,其实现类实现具体功能
package com.lgd.ssh.spider.Dao.Spi;
import redis.clients.jedis.Pipeline;
public interface RedisExecute<T> {
public T Execute(Pipeline pipeline);
}
redisDao对应实现类
package com.lgd.ssh.spider.Dao.Spi;
import java.util.HashMap;
import java.util.List;
import java.util.Map;
import org.apache.log4j.Logger;
import com.lgd.ssh.spider.Dao.RedisDao;
import redis.clients.jedis.Pipeline;
import redis.clients.jedis.Response;
public class RedisDaoSpi extends RedisBaseDao implements RedisDao {
private Logger logger = Logger.getLogger(RedisDaoSpi.class);
public void add(final Map<String, String> addMap) {
if (logger.isDebugEnabled()) {
logger.debug("start RedisDaoSpi.add");
}
RedisExecute(new RedisExecute<Void>() {
public Void Execute(Pipeline pipeline) {
pipeline.multi();
for (Map.Entry<String, String> entry : addMap.entrySet()) {
pipeline.setnx(entry.getKey(), entry.getValue());
}
pipeline.exec();
pipeline.syncAndReturnAll();
return null;
}
});
if (logger.isDebugEnabled()) {
logger.debug("end RedisDaoSpi.add");
}
}
public void delete(final List<String> deleteList) {
if (logger.isDebugEnabled()) {
logger.debug("start RedisDaoSpi.delete");
}
RedisExecute(new RedisExecute<Void>() {
public Void Execute(Pipeline pipeline) {
pipeline.multi();
for (String key : deleteList) {
pipeline.del(key);
}
pipeline.exec();
pipeline.syncAndReturnAll();
return null;
}
});
if (logger.isDebugEnabled()) {
logger.debug("end RedisDaoSpi.delete");
}
}
public void update(final Map<String, String> updateMap) {
if (logger.isDebugEnabled()) {
logger.debug("start RedisDaoSpi.update");
}
RedisExecute(new RedisExecute<Void>() {
public Void Execute(Pipeline pipeline) {
pipeline.multi();
for (Map.Entry<String, String> entry : updateMap.entrySet()) {
pipeline.set(entry.getKey(), entry.getValue());
}
pipeline.exec();
pipeline.syncAndReturnAll();
return null;
}
});
if (logger.isDebugEnabled()) {
logger.debug("end RedisDaoSpi.update");
}
}
public Map<String, String> query(final List<String> queryList) {
if (logger.isDebugEnabled()) {
logger.debug("start RedisDaoSpi.query");
}
Map<String, String> getMap = RedisExecute(new RedisExecute<Map<String, String>>() {
public Map<String, String> Execute(Pipeline pipeline) {
Map<String, Response<String>> getMap = new HashMap<String, Response<String>>();
pipeline.multi();
for (String key : queryList) {
getMap.put(key, pipeline.get(key));
}
pipeline.exec();
pipeline.syncAndReturnAll();
Map<String, String> resultMap = new HashMap<String, String>();
for (Map.Entry<String, Response<String>> entry : getMap.entrySet()) {
resultMap.put(entry.getKey(), entry.getValue().get());
}
return resultMap;
}
});
if (logger.isDebugEnabled()) {
logger.debug("end RedisDaoSpi.query");
}
return getMap;
}
}
4.bean配置
redis.properties文件
# Redis settings
redis.host=localhost
redis.port=6379
redis.pass=P@ssw0rd
redis.maxIdle=300
redis.maxActive=600
redis.maxWait=1000
redis.testOnBorrow=true
redis.spring.xml
<?xml version="1.0" encoding="UTF-8"?>
<beans xmlns="http://www.springframework.org/schema/beans"
x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xmlns:p="http://www.springframework.org/schema/p"
xmlns:context="http://www.springframework.org/schema/context"
xmlns:jee="http://www.springframework.org/schema/jee" xmlns:tx="http://www.springframework.org/schema/tx"
xmlns:aop="http://www.springframework.org/schema/aop"
xsi:schemaLocation="
http://www.springframework.org/schema/beans http://www.springframework.org/schema/beans/spring-beans.xsd
http://www.springframework.org/schema/context http://www.springframework.org/schema/context/spring-context.xsd">
<context:property-placeholder location="classpath:properties/redis.properties" />
<bean id="jedisPoolConfig" class="redis.clients.jedis.JedisPoolConfig">
<property name="maxIdle" value="${redis.maxIdle}" />
<property name="maxActive" value="${redis.maxActive}" />
<property name="maxWait" value="${redis.maxWait}" />
<property name="testOnBorrow" value="${redis.testOnBorrow}" />
</bean>
<bean id="jedisPool" class="redis.clients.jedis.JedisPool">
<constructor-arg index="0" ref="jedisPoolConfig" />
<constructor-arg index="1" value="${redis.host}" />
<constructor-arg index="2" value="${redis.port}" type="int" />
</bean>
<bean id="redisBaseDao" class="com.lgd.ssh.spider.Dao.Spi.RedisBaseDao">
<property name="jedisPool" ref="jedisPool"></property>
</bean>
<bean id="redisDao" class="com.lgd.ssh.spider.Dao.Spi.RedisDaoSpi" parent="redisBaseDao">
</bean>
</beans>
